当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储的类型有哪些,对象存储和非对象存储的区别是什么

对象存储的类型有哪些,对象存储和非对象存储的区别是什么

***:此内容主要聚焦于对象存储相关问题。一是探讨对象存储的类型,但未给出具体类型相关内容。二是关注对象存储与非对象存储的区别,同样未阐述两者区别的实际内容。整体只是提...

***:本内容主要聚焦于对象存储相关问题。一是探究对象存储的类型,但未给出具体类型相关信息。二是关注对象存储和非对象存储的区别,同样未涉及两者区别的具体阐述。整体围绕这两个关于对象存储的关键问题展开,旨在了解对象存储的类型划分以及与非对象存储在概念、功能、应用场景等方面可能存在的差异等内容。

本文目录导读:

  1. 对象存储与非对象存储的区别
  2. 对象存储的类型

深度解析二者的区别及对象存储的类型

对象存储与非对象存储的区别

(一)数据结构

1、对象存储

- 在对象存储中,数据以对象的形式存在,一个对象包含了数据本身、元数据(如对象的大小、创建时间、所有者等信息)以及一个唯一标识符(通常是一个全局唯一的ID),这种结构使得对象存储在处理大规模、非结构化数据时非常高效,在存储海量的图片、视频等文件时,每个图片或视频都可以作为一个独立的对象,方便进行管理和检索。

对象存储的类型有哪些,对象存储和非对象存储的区别是什么

2、非对象存储(以传统的块存储和文件存储为例)

块存储:数据被分割成固定大小的块,块存储系统主要关注的是这些块的存储和管理,块存储通常需要与特定的操作系统或应用程序配合使用,因为它没有对象存储那样丰富的元数据信息,在企业级的数据库应用中,块存储可以为数据库提供底层的存储空间,数据库管理系统需要自己管理数据在块中的组织和索引。

文件存储:数据以文件和文件夹的结构组织,文件存储系统提供了类似操作系统文件系统的功能,如创建、删除、读取和写入文件等操作,它适合于共享文件和存储有一定结构的文本文件等,但在处理海量的非结构化数据时,可能会面临性能和管理上的挑战,因为文件系统的目录结构在大规模数据情况下可能变得复杂且难以维护。

(二)可扩展性

1、对象存储

- 对象存储具有极高的可扩展性,它可以轻松地扩展到数亿甚至数十亿个对象的规模,这是因为对象存储的架构是分布式的,多个存储节点可以并行工作,当需要增加存储容量时,可以简单地添加新的存储节点到集群中,新节点可以立即参与到数据的存储和检索工作中,云服务提供商的对象存储服务可以根据用户的需求动态地扩展存储容量,满足企业不断增长的数据存储需求。

2、非对象存储

块存储:块存储的可扩展性相对有限,在传统的企业级存储系统中,扩展块存储往往需要复杂的配置和硬件升级过程,增加磁盘阵列的容量可能需要停机进行硬件安装和配置调整,而且随着存储容量的增加,管理复杂度也会显著提高。

文件存储:文件存储的可扩展性也面临挑战,当文件系统中的文件数量过多时,文件查找和访问的性能可能会下降,虽然可以通过分布式文件系统来提高可扩展性,但与对象存储相比,其扩展的灵活性和效率仍然较低。

(三)数据访问方式

1、对象存储

- 对象存储通过对象的唯一标识符进行数据访问,这种访问方式非常适合基于互联网的大规模数据访问,在内容分发网络(CDN)中,对象存储中的图片、脚本等对象可以通过其唯一的URL(对应于对象的唯一标识符)被快速地访问和分发到全球各地的用户,对象存储还支持基于HTTP/HTTPS协议的访问,这使得它可以方便地与各种网络应用集成。

2、非对象存储

块存储:块存储通常需要通过特定的块设备接口(如SCSI、iSCSI等)进行访问,这需要在操作系统或应用程序中进行专门的配置,并且访问块存储的设备往往需要特定的权限和驱动程序,在服务器上挂载一个块存储设备时,需要安装相应的驱动程序并进行分区、格式化等操作才能正常使用。

文件存储:文件存储通过文件路径进行访问,这种访问方式类似于本地文件系统的访问,用户可以使用文件共享协议(如NFS、SMB等)来访问远程文件存储中的文件,这种访问方式在跨网络和大规模数据访问时可能会受到网络带宽和协议本身性能的限制。

(四)数据管理和安全性

1、对象存储

对象存储的类型有哪些,对象存储和非对象存储的区别是什么

数据管理:对象存储的元数据管理功能使得数据管理更加灵活,管理员可以通过元数据对对象进行分类、搜索和过滤,可以根据对象的创建时间、所有者或内容类型等元数据信息快速定位和管理对象,对象存储可以支持对象级别的操作,如对象的复制、移动和删除等,方便进行数据的生命周期管理。

安全性:对象存储提供了多种安全机制,可以在对象级别设置访问权限,通过身份验证和授权机制确保只有授权用户可以访问特定的对象,在云对象存储中,可以使用访问密钥和签名等方式来验证用户的身份,并根据用户的权限设置允许或禁止对对象的访问,对象存储还可以通过加密技术保护数据的机密性,无论是在存储过程中还是在数据传输过程中。

2、非对象存储

数据管理

块存储:块存储的管理主要集中在块的分配和存储布局上,由于缺乏丰富的元数据信息,块存储在数据管理方面相对较为粗放,在管理块存储中的数据库数据时,主要依靠数据库管理系统自身的管理功能,而块存储系统本身对数据内容的管理能力有限。

文件存储:文件存储的管理依赖于文件系统的目录结构,在大规模文件存储场景下,文件系统的管理可能会变得复杂,文件的权限管理、文件的备份和恢复等操作都需要在文件系统的框架下进行,并且可能会受到文件系统本身功能的限制。

安全性

块存储:块存储的安全性主要通过对块设备的访问控制来实现,限制对块存储设备的物理连接访问,以及在操作系统或存储管理软件中设置用户对块设备的访问权限,这种安全机制相对较为基础,缺乏对象存储那样细粒度的对象级安全控制。

文件存储:文件存储通过文件和文件夹的权限设置来保证安全性,在多用户、多应用共享文件存储的环境中,权限管理可能会变得复杂且容易出现漏洞,文件存储在数据传输过程中的安全保障也相对有限,需要额外的安全措施(如VPN等)来确保数据的安全传输。

对象存储的类型

(一)公有云对象存储

1、特点

成本效益高:公有云对象存储由云服务提供商提供,多个用户可以共享这些存储资源,这使得企业无需自己构建和维护庞大的存储基础设施,大大降低了存储成本,小型企业可以使用亚马逊S3(Simple Storage Service)或阿里云的对象存储服务来存储企业数据,只需按照使用量付费,无需投入大量资金购买硬件设备和建设数据中心。

可扩展性强:公有云对象存储能够根据用户的需求快速扩展存储容量,云服务提供商拥有大规模的数据中心和分布式存储架构,可以轻松应对企业数据量的增长,当一家电商企业在促销活动期间数据量突然增大时,其使用的公有云对象存储可以自动扩展容量以容纳新增的数据,活动结束后再根据实际使用情况调整容量。

高可用性:公有云对象存储通常具有多个数据中心和冗余备份机制,云服务提供商通过在不同地理位置的数据中心存储数据副本,确保数据的高可用性,即使某个数据中心发生故障,用户的数据仍然可以从其他数据中心获取,谷歌云存储在全球多个地区都有数据中心,为用户提供了高可靠性的存储服务。

2、应用场景

中小企业数据存储:对于中小企业来说,公有云对象存储是一种理想的选择,它们可以将企业的文档、图片、视频等数据存储在公有云对象存储中,方便员工随时随地访问,由于无需自己建设和管理存储设施,中小企业可以将更多的精力和资源投入到核心业务的发展上。

互联网应用数据存储:许多互联网应用,如社交媒体、内容分享平台等,需要存储海量的用户生成内容(UGC),公有云对象存储可以满足这些应用对存储容量和可扩展性的要求,Instagram需要存储大量的用户照片,使用公有云对象存储可以确保这些照片的安全存储和快速访问。

对象存储的类型有哪些,对象存储和非对象存储的区别是什么

(二)私有云对象存储

1、特点

定制性强:私有云对象存储是企业自己构建和管理的对象存储系统,企业可以根据自身的需求对存储系统进行定制,企业可以根据自身的安全策略、数据管理流程等要求,定制对象存储的元数据结构、访问控制机制等。

安全性高:由于私有云对象存储是企业内部使用的,企业可以更好地控制数据的安全性,企业可以采用自己的安全措施,如企业内部的身份验证系统、加密算法等,确保数据不被外部访问,与公有云对象存储相比,私有云对象存储更适合存储企业的敏感数据,如企业的财务数据、客户信息等。

与企业内部系统集成方便:私有云对象存储可以与企业内部的其他系统(如企业资源计划(ERP)系统、客户关系管理(CRM)系统等)进行深度集成,企业可以将ERP系统中的文档和报表等数据存储在私有云对象存储中,并通过内部网络实现数据的快速共享和交互。

2、应用场景

大型企业敏感数据存储:大型企业往往有大量的敏感数据需要存储,如金融机构的交易数据、医疗机构的患者病历等,私有云对象存储可以为这些企业提供一个安全、定制化的存储解决方案,满足企业对数据安全和隐私保护的要求。

企业内部数据共享和协作:在企业内部,不同部门之间需要共享和协作处理数据,私有云对象存储可以作为企业内部的数据共享平台,方便各部门存储、访问和共享数据,企业的研发部门和市场部门可以通过私有云对象存储共享产品文档、市场调研数据等,提高企业内部的工作效率。

(三)混合云对象存储

1、特点

灵活性:混合云对象存储结合了公有云和私有云对象存储的优点,企业可以根据数据的性质和需求,将不同类型的数据分别存储在公有云和私有云中,企业可以将非敏感的公共数据(如企业宣传资料、公开的产品文档等)存储在公有云对象存储中,以利用公有云的成本效益和可扩展性;而将敏感数据(如企业的核心业务数据、客户隐私信息等)存储在私有云对象存储中,以确保数据的安全性。

数据迁移和整合:混合云对象存储允许企业在公有云和私有云之间进行数据迁移和整合,当企业的业务需求发生变化时,例如企业决定将部分公有云存储的数据迁移到私有云以提高安全性,或者将私有云存储的数据迁移到公有云以降低成本,混合云对象存储可以提供相应的工具和机制来实现数据的平滑迁移和整合。

灾难恢复:混合云对象存储可以作为企业的灾难恢复解决方案,企业可以在公有云和私有云中分别存储数据副本,当企业内部的私有云存储发生故障时,可以从公有云中快速恢复数据;反之,当公有云出现问题时,也可以从私有云中获取数据,提高企业数据的可用性和抗灾能力。

2、应用场景

企业数据分级存储:企业可以根据数据的重要性、敏感性和使用频率等因素对数据进行分级,将经常访问的非敏感数据存储在公有云对象存储中,将不经常访问但非常重要的敏感数据存储在私有云对象存储中,实现数据的优化存储和管理。

企业数字化转型过程中的存储需求:在企业数字化转型过程中,企业的存储需求往往是复杂多样的,混合云对象存储可以满足企业在不同阶段、不同业务场景下的存储需求,在企业开展新的互联网业务时,可以先利用公有云对象存储进行数据存储和业务测试,随着业务的发展和数据的重要性增加,再逐步将部分数据迁移到私有云对象存储中。

黑狐家游戏

发表评论

最新文章